DeFi Saver Integrates Hyperliquid: 50,000 USDC Prize Pool Up for Grabs
DeFi Saver now integrates Hyperliquid, merging DeFi lending with perpetual futures trading in one space. A 50,000 USDC prize pool awaits in their latest incentive campaign.
DeFi Saver's latest move brings Hyperliquid, a major player in perpetual futures, right to its platform. This isn't just about adding a feature. it's about merging futures trading and DeFi lending into one effortless experience. Users can now manage their entire DeFi strategy in one place, directly from the sidebar of DeFi Saver's app. It's a bold move toward creating a full trading environment.
The integration makes things frictionless. Connect your wallet and you're in. No hoops to jump through, just immediate access to a powerful trading dashboard. And here's where it gets even more interesting: DeFi Saver's advanced management tools are already in place. You get automation capabilities like trailing open and close strategies, perfect for precise market movements. Soon, they'll roll out a Notify feature for Telegram alerts, keeping traders informed about position health, which is a critical feature in volatile markets.
Starting June 8th, things heat up with a 50,000 USDC prize pool spread across two seasons. This isn't small change. Rewards are based on volume and PnL, which amplifies the allure for high-volume traders.
